——'猎人 发表于 2012-5-27 12:09:00

汇编第六章实验五有疑问,谢谢

1      assume cs:code
2      a segment
3         db 1,2,3,4,5,6,7,8
4      a ends
5      b segment
6         db 1,2,3,4,5,6,7,8
7      b ends
8       c segment
9          db 0,0,0,0,0,0,0,0
10   c ends
11   code segment
12   start: mov ax, a
13         mov ds, ax
14         mov ax, b
15         mov ss, ax
16         mov ax, c
17         mov es, ax
18         mov bx, 0
19      
20            mov cx, 8
21      s: mov al,
22          add al, ss:
23          mov es:, al
24          inc bx
25          loop s
26   
27          mov ax,4c00h
28          int 21h
29   code ends
30   end start

怎么编译不了
<8> : error A2008:    :   c
<9> : error A2034:   
<10>: error A2008:    :c
<16>: error A2008:    :c

这个到底是什么意思?求解译

Yara 发表于 2012-5-27 12:49:40

c是关键字,所以要改一下c,可以改为cc

乘风追日 发表于 2012-5-27 13:23:20

Yara 发表于 2012-5-27 12:49 static/image/common/back.gif
c是关键字,所以要改一下c,可以改为cc

还有关键字一说啊,学到十章了,今天才知道。受教了{:5_109:}

——'猎人 发表于 2012-5-27 15:02:56

Yara 发表于 2012-5-27 12:49 static/image/common/back.gif
c是关键字,所以要改一下c,可以改为cc

如果是关键字,怎么书上都没提示的呢?{:5_90:}
还有小甲鱼老师也是

Yara 发表于 2012-5-27 17:28:03

——'猎人 发表于 2012-5-27 15:02 static/image/common/back.gif
如果是关键字,怎么书上都没提示的呢?
还有小甲鱼老师也是

{:5_91:}我说的关键字类似于C和C++里的关键字而已,在汇编中可能不叫关键字,总之c这个字母在汇编中不可以做标志号,还有,很多知识不是书上不说,或者谁谁谁不讲就不代表没有的,学习要自己去主动挖掘下,而不是被动去接受的
页: [1]
查看完整版本: 汇编第六章实验五有疑问,谢谢